No, they are not the same. Though they might have a lot in common. Aviation course has a larger context compared to airport management.
Air hostess, pilots, aeronautical engineering all comes under aviation. Even airport management comes under Aviation.
Airport management involves the ground team, ATC, security, services, etc.

There are 3 ways to become pilot after 12th in India:
1. Join in a DGCA approved flying school and complete your Private Pilot License (PPL) / Commercial Pilot License (CPL) and join as a pilot in an airline.
2. Complete your Bachelors in aeronautical engineering and then go through the above mentioned way.
3. Apply for exams like National Defence Academy (NDA) and become a government trained pilot with free of cost training.

B.Sc in Aviation Science is 3 years long program which deals with the study, design and operation of flight capable machine (aircraft, helicopters, gliders etc).
A graduade in the above mentioned course can take up various professions, for example:
1. Mechanic (aircraft designing, manufacturing, maintenance)
2. Pilot
3. Flight Attendant
4. Air Traffic Controller
5. Cargo Manager
6. Airport Ground Operations Manager
